Archive for May, 2008

Pardus ve wxPython

Saturday, May 10th, 2008

Hatırlat'ın tasarımını Pardus üzerinde kontrol etmek istedim ancak wxPython paketini paket yöneticisinde bulamadım(2.8 sürümü). Biraz araştırmadan sonra pspec.xml ile nasıl .pisi dosyası oluşturulacağını öğrendim. wxGTK ve wxPython inşa dosyalarını contrib içerisinde buldum (Hazırlayanların elleri dert görmesin , geany bile varmış orada ).
(more...)

wxPython İçin Örnek Bir Hakkında Diyaloğu

Thursday, May 8th, 2008

wxPython'un kendine özel bir hakkında diyaloğu var ama açıklamaları yazarken sorunlar çıktığından ben bir tane oluşturayım dedim. Kodlar biraz uzun aşağıda sadece örnek kullanımı ve ekran görüntüsü mevcut. Kodları buradan indirebilirsiniz.
(more...)

ShelveSQL

Wednesday, May 7th, 2008

Python ile uğraşanlar bilirler. Küçük (ya da büyük) işlerde bilgileri kaydedebilmek için genelde shelve modülü kullanılır. İşlevsel olduğu için ben daha önce bunu Unutmak Yok adlı programda kullanmıştım. Yalnız bu modülde diğer veritabanı işlemlerinde olduğu gibi sql cümleleri ile sorgu yapılamıyor (bildiğim kadarıyla). Aklımın bir köşesinde shelve ile sql kodlarının uyumlu bir şekilde çalışmasını sağlamak gibi bir düşünce vardı bir süreden beri.
(more...)

Sunucuları Bağlanma Hızlarına Göre Sıralama

Wednesday, May 7th, 2008

Geçen gün kurduğum Ubuntu'da ki yazılım kaynakları uygulamasında rastladım böyle bir özelliğe. Paket sunucusu seçme bölümünde  "en iyi sunucuyu seç" butonu ile en hızlı sunucu bulunulabiliyor. Python ile buna benzer bir uygulama yapmaya çalıştım. Bir nebze başarılı olduğum söylenebilir. Tabi mantıksal bir hata yapmamış isem.
(more...)